描述
do_ocr_multi_class_mlpdo_ocr_multi_class_mlpDoOcrMultiClassMlpDoOcrMultiClassMlpDoOcrMultiClassMlpdo_ocr_multi_class_mlp computes the best class for each of
the characters given by the regions CharacterCharacterCharacterCharactercharactercharacter and the gray
values ImageImageImageImageimageimage with the OCR classifier OCRHandleOCRHandleOCRHandleOCRHandleOCRHandleocrhandle and
returns the classes in ClassClassClassClassclassValclass and the corresponding
confidences (probabilities) of the classes in ConfidenceConfidenceConfidenceConfidenceconfidenceconfidence.
In contrast to do_ocr_single_class_mlpdo_ocr_single_class_mlpDoOcrSingleClassMlpDoOcrSingleClassMlpDoOcrSingleClassMlpdo_ocr_single_class_mlp,
do_ocr_multi_class_mlpdo_ocr_multi_class_mlpDoOcrMultiClassMlpDoOcrMultiClassMlpDoOcrMultiClassMlpdo_ocr_multi_class_mlp can classify multiple characters in
one call, and therefore typically is faster than a loop that uses
do_ocr_single_class_mlpdo_ocr_single_class_mlpDoOcrSingleClassMlpDoOcrSingleClassMlpDoOcrSingleClassMlpdo_ocr_single_class_mlp to classify single characters.
However, do_ocr_multi_class_mlpdo_ocr_multi_class_mlpDoOcrMultiClassMlpDoOcrMultiClassMlpDoOcrMultiClassMlpdo_ocr_multi_class_mlp can only return the best
class of each character. Because the confidences can be interpreted
as probabilities (see classify_class_mlpclassify_class_mlpClassifyClassMlpClassifyClassMlpClassifyClassMlpclassify_class_mlp and
evaluate_class_mlpevaluate_class_mlpEvaluateClassMlpEvaluateClassMlpEvaluateClassMlpevaluate_class_mlp), and it is therefore easy to check
whether a character has been classified with too much uncertainty,
this is usually not a disadvantage, except in cases where the
classes overlap so much that in many cases the second best class
must be examined to be able to decide the class of the character.
In these cases, do_ocr_single_class_mlpdo_ocr_single_class_mlpDoOcrSingleClassMlpDoOcrSingleClassMlpDoOcrSingleClassMlpdo_ocr_single_class_mlp should be used.
A string of the number
'\032'"\032""\032""\032""\032""\032" (alternatively
displayed as '\0x1A'"\0x1A""\0x1A""\0x1A""\0x1A""\0x1A") in
ClassClassClassClassclassValclass signifies that the region has been classified as rejection
class.
Before calling do_ocr_multi_class_mlpdo_ocr_multi_class_mlpDoOcrMultiClassMlpDoOcrMultiClassMlpDoOcrMultiClassMlpdo_ocr_multi_class_mlp, the classifier must be
trained with trainf_ocr_class_mlptrainf_ocr_class_mlpTrainfOcrClassMlpTrainfOcrClassMlpTrainfOcrClassMlptrainf_ocr_class_mlp。
